What it is
L-ornithine is a non-protein amino acid, meaning it is not incorporated into proteins. It is produced in the body from arginine and functions primarily within the urea cycle, the pathway that converts ammonia into urea for excretion.
Dietary intake is minimal, since it is not a protein constituent. It appears in small amounts in some foods but is essentially obtained through internal synthesis from arginine.
It is often paired with arginine in supplements on the basis of their metabolic relationship, and ornithine alpha-ketoglutarate, or OKG, is a separate compound combining ornithine with a citric acid cycle intermediate, studied mainly in clinical nutrition rather than sport.
How it works
Within the urea cycle, ornithine combines with carbamoyl phosphate to begin the sequence that converts ammonia into urea. Supplying additional ornithine is proposed to support the cycle's capacity to clear ammonia.
This matters for exercise because ammonia accumulates during prolonged or intense effort and contributes to both peripheral and central fatigue. Improved clearance would in principle delay that.
The growth hormone rationale comes from studies using intravenous administration at high doses, which does produce a growth hormone spike. Oral doses at supplemental levels produce a far smaller and transient response, and there is no good evidence that this translates into muscle or body composition change. This is a case where an intravenous finding was carried into oral marketing without justification.
What the evidence shows
Evidence for muscle growth, strength or body composition is weak, and trials in trained individuals have generally found no meaningful benefit. The growth hormone story does not hold up at oral doses.
More interesting findings concern fatigue and stress. A Japanese trial reported reduced subjective fatigue and improved sleep quality alongside favourable changes in stress hormone markers, and other small trials have reported reduced ammonia accumulation during endurance exercise.
There is a larger body of supervised research using the related compound OKG, but that concerns a different compound in a different setting. Overall ornithine is a modest ingredient whose supplement positioning does not match where its evidence actually sits.
Dosing
Common supplemental range is 400 mg to 2 g daily. The fatigue and sleep research used around 400 mg daily, which is at the lower end and reassuringly modest.
Higher doses of 2-6 g have been used in ammonia and endurance research, taken before exercise, but gastrointestinal tolerance becomes limiting above roughly 3 g.
Often taken in the evening given the sleep and fatigue findings, or before endurance work if the goal is ammonia clearance. If muscle growth is the goal, the evidence does not support taking it at all.

Safety and side effects
Generally well tolerated at typical doses. The main adverse effect is gastrointestinal, with cramping and diarrhoea reported at higher intakes, particularly above 3 g in a single serving.
Because ornithine and arginine share transport mechanisms, taking large doses of both together may reduce absorption of each, which is worth knowing given how often they are combined in products.
Long-term safety data at supplemental doses is limited. Anyone under medical care should check before use.
Who should avoid it
Speak to your doctor before use if you take regular medication or are under medical care. Take care alongside high-dose arginine, given shared transport. Not established for use in pregnancy or breastfeeding at supplemental doses. Reduce the dose if digestive symptoms occur.
